Leadership & Business Development - Franco Logistics Inc. | Transloading , Drayage , Fulfillment, OTR Services |
There’s alot of murmur going around regarding CARB and ACF. Not much has actually changed regarding whether or not truckers still need to register by 2024 on TRUCRS or CTC. Short answer is YES truckers still should have registered by 12/31/23.
